Live Casino Fundamentals: Building Your Foundation

Live casino games stream real dealers in real time. You watch a professional shuffle cards, spin a roulette wheel, or deal blackjack hands from a studio or a real casino floor. The software captures every move and sends it to your screen with a tiny delay.

Why Odds Matter

The odds you face in a live game are set by the house edge, just like any other casino product. However, because a human dealer handles the cards, the randomness is truly physical. This can give players a feeling of control, especially in games like blackjack where strategy reduces the house edge to as low as 0.5 % when you use basic strategy.

Key Terms

Term Meaning
House Edge The average profit the casino expects from each bet.
RTP (Return to Player) Percentage of wagered money a game returns over the long run.
Volatility How often and how big wins are. Low volatility = frequent small wins; high volatility = rare big wins.
Paylines Lines on a slot reel that determine winning combinations.

RNG Games Fundamentals: Building Your Foundation

RNG (Random Number Generator) games include slots, video poker, and many instant‑win titles. The software uses a mathematical algorithm to produce outcomes that are statistically random. No human interaction is involved, which means the game runs 24/7 without a dealer.

Why Odds Matter

RNG slots display an RTP value, usually between 92 % and 98 %. This figure tells you how much of the total money wagered will be paid back over time. A higher RTP generally means better long‑term odds for the player.

Key Terms

  • Jackpot – A massive prize that can be won by hitting a rare combination.
  • Wagering Requirement – The amount you must bet before you can withdraw bonus winnings.
  • Hit Frequency – How often a spin results in any win, regardless of size.
  • Scatter Symbol – Triggers free spins or bonus rounds when appearing anywhere on the reels.

Optimization and Fine‑Tuning

Even after you pick a game type, there are ways to improve your odds further.

  • Use Basic Strategy in Blackjack: A simple chart can cut the house edge to under 1 %.
  • Bet on Even‑Money Options in Roulette: Red/black or odd/even bets have the lowest house edge (≈2.7 % on European wheels).

Q: Do RNG slots have a higher house edge than live tables?
A: It varies. Some slots have RTPs of 97 % (house edge 3 %), while certain live blackjack games can have a house edge below 1 % with perfect strategy.
